YouTube seems to be buffering streams,, because I don't believe for a minute that the MV was getting 2M plays a day and then suddenly only gets 400K or less. I'll look into Pandora, though they only pay $0.001 per stream while Spotify pays three times as much, and Amazon 4 times as much. (and Apple 8 times...) The only problem with Apple Music is: If you have purchased a song on iTunes, they will NOT count any of your streaming of it unless you delete the song from your library. So you can buy a song or an album and that counts for ""buy" charts but you have to delete it entirely if you want streams to count. I'm mad at Weverse because when they said you had rental VODs for 7 days, what they meant is 168 hours from exact time of purchase, so I used the stupid Jellies to get the Festa package but was a few hours too late going back on to watch what I hadn't yet seen. Note to self: they mean EXACT hours, not days...
